Dickson appoints Soriwei as CPS

Dickson

Governor Seriake Dickson of Bayelsa State, on Thursday, appointed a new Chief Press Secretary (CPS), Mr Fidelis Soriwei.
Mr Daniel Iworiso-Markson, Commisioner for Information, who announced this in a statement in Yenagoa, said the appointment took immediate effect.
Iworiso-Markson said that Soriwei would take over from Dr. Francis Ottah-Agbo who had since resigned from the position.
Soriwei, until his new role, was the Special Adviser to the Governor on Media Relations.
Ottah-Agbo was elected member of the House of Representatives.
He is representing the Ado/Okpokwu/Ogbadibo Federal Constituency of Benue State on the platform of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P).
